Canowindra@home 2014 Long Lunch Ticket Release

30 January, 2014 By Canowindra Phoenix Editor

Table

The Canowindra@home team is heating up 2014 by promptly preparing for this year’s regional food and wine events, with focus still remaining on showcasing the region’s bounty of season produce and award winning wineries.

Kicking off 2014 will be the Canowindra@ home 100 Mile Long Lunch on Sunday 6th April. Tickets will go on sale at 9:00 am Mon- day 10th February and are to be purchased online @ www.canowindraathome.org.au. Please visit the website to subscribe for event reminders or Like Us on Facebook. Last year’s event sold out within 48 hours.

“We received overwhelming positive feed- back for last years’ event and this year’s format will be slightly different, but we are still looking to host an outdoor lunch to take advantage of our beautiful autumn days”, Canowindra@home president Helen Tinney explained.

The 100 Mile Lunch will marry the talents of local chefs with the ‘best of the best’ from of our local producers and winemakers. This year’s event will once again be held in the relaxed and comfortable grounds of the Age of Fishes Museum in Canowindra. For those unfamiliar to the event it takes its influence from the slow food movement, centering around long communal tables perfect for enjoying and sharing food, wine and good times.

For entertainment, the team has once again secured the great sounds of Trouble with Johnny featuring Cecelia Rochelli with a French Jazz theme to suit the occasion.
